The Itinerary Breakdown

The tour kicks off with hotel pickup in Falmouth, where a comfortable air-conditioned bus whisks you away towards Discovery Bay. The first stop, Columbus Park, is a brief but meaningful visit. This site marks the landing spot of Christopher Columbus in 1494 and adds a touch of historical context to your day. While the visit is only 15 minutes, it’s enough to snap a few photos and appreciate the significance of the location.

Next, you’ll head to Dunn’s River Falls, where your guide will assist you as you climb the terraced waterfalls. The climb typically takes around two hours, and you’ll be provided with a swimsuit and water shoes. What makes this experience so special is the guided assistance, which boosts your confidence and ensures safety while allowing you to enjoy the stunning views and lush surroundings. The actual climb offers spectacular panoramic vistas of the surrounding countryside, making it a highlight for many travelers.

After working up an appetite, you have the option to purchase a traditional Jamaican jerk lunch at a nearby restaurant—an opportunity to savor local flavors—before heading to the Glistening Waters Marina in Falmouth.

The final act is the Luminous Lagoon boat cruise. As you step aboard a glass-bottom boat, you’ll be transported into waters that glow with an eerie, beautiful light caused by harmless phytoplankton. If you’re feeling adventurous, bring your swimsuit and take a dip in the luminous water. Many reviewers have delighted in swimming among the tiny creatures that make the lagoon shimmer, describing it as a truly magical experience.
